Standard Practice for Electrical Leak Location on Exposed Geomembranes Using the Water Lance Method

SKU149697538 Published by ASTM International, formerly American Society for Testing and Materials ASTM Publication Date2022 Pages CountPages5

The ASTM D7703-22 standard provides guidelines for the electrical method of locating leaks in exposed geomembranes. The standard defines a "leak" as any type of breach in an installed geomembrane, such as holes, punctures, tears, seam defects, cracks, or knife cuts.

This practice is applicable for geomembranes installed in various containment facilities, including basins, ponds, tanks, ore and waste pads, landfill cells, landfill caps, and canals. It is suitable for geomembranes made of different materials, such as polyethylene, polypropylene, polyvinyl chloride, chlorosulfonated polyethylene, bituminous geomembranes, and other electrically insulating materials.

The standard emphasizes that the proper preparations must be made during the construction of the facility to effectively utilize this practice for locating geomembrane leaks. This ensures that the method is most applicable and accurate in identifying leaks in exposed geomembranes.
